본문 바로가기

exercise

Exercise 17-2 욕 판별 함수 작성하기. Exercise 17-2 욕 판별 함수 작성하기. 윷놀이 게임 개발팀에서 채팅 내용이 욕인지 구별하는 함수의 작성을 요청해왔다. 아래는 함수의 원형과 사용이 금지된 욕의 리스트가 있다. 인자로 넘겨진 문자열이 욕 리스트에 있는 문자열과 일치하는 경우 true를 반환하도록 구현해보자. bool IsTermOfAbuse (const char* pChatMessage );바보, 병신, 나쁜, 미친 #include #include void IsTermOfAbuse(string sentance);//비속어가 들어가면 경고하고, 아닌경우 sentance를 출력. void main() { string bad1 = "뭔데";//욕이 들어간 문자열 string bad2 = "병신아";//욕이 들어간 문자열 string .. 더보기
뇌를 자극하는 JAVA 프로그래밍 - Exercise 86 Page Exercise - 86 페이지 Exercise 2-2예제 2-27 과 똑같은 기능을 하는 프로그램을 switch 문을 대신 else if 절을 갖는 if문을 이용해서 작성하십시오. 예제 2-27----------------- class SwitchExample1 { public static void main(String args[]) { int num = 3; switch (num) { case 1: System.out.println("Good Morning, Java"); break; case 2: System.out.println("Good Afternoon, Java"); break; case 3: System.out.println("Good Evening, Java"); break; defaul.. 더보기
뇌를 자극하는 C++ 프로그래밍 복사 생성자 Exercise 21-2 복사생성자 관련. 예제 코드.와 Exercise 21-2 #include using namespace std; class Point {//클래스 정의. public: int x, y;//멤버 변수 void print();//멤버 함수 Point();//생성자들 Point(int initialX, int initialY); Point(const Point& pt); //복사생성자 }; Point::Point(const Point& pt) { cout 더보기
뇌를 자극하는 C++ 프로그래밍 Exercise Exercise 21-1 내마음대로 코딩한 문제. 문제 내용은 distancefromorigin 을 멤버함수로 만들어서 두 값을 입력하여 대각선의 거리를 반환하는 것. #include #include #include using namespace std; class Point { public: int x, y; float z; float DistanceFromOrigin() { int a,b; //int값으로 받음 a= x*x; b= y*y; z = sqrt((float)a+(float)b); //계산된 값들을 float형으로 바꾼뒤 제곱근을 계산. return z;// z를 리턴. } void print(){ DistanceFromOrigin();//위의 멤버함수를 먼저 동작시킨 후 프린팅. printf.. 더보기